Output eb17d2e9a1f6dcb9ed2ae5ca37b0d82daa881e9745f15fa49ef476c95d1ce129:28

value
1899740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8feee8c944f08434fe32d95fdacae9d1f738c53 OP_EQUAL
address
3H6aqkCBfvTsHM9ELLdNmQoX5C1TAgej9b
transaction
eb17d2e9a1f6dcb9ed2ae5ca37b0d82daa881e9745f15fa49ef476c95d1ce129
confirmations
408602
spent
true